The first Accredited Staging Professional “Master” (ASPM) in Manhattan, Anne Kenney is a veteran of Barbara Schwarz’s Stagedhomes.com training program. After personally studying with Ms. Schwarz in California, Anne returned to NYC and has been helping sellers receive maximum return on properties of all ages and styles. “Staging is a powerful marketing tool”, Anne says.” It’s packaging and it’s strategic. I believe it’s important to have a clear, articulated strategy for every staging we do.” “To get the best results for our clients, we must identify and rectify challenges that will present obstacles to its sale. In order to do this, we tap into our team of stagers, professional organizers, designers, contractors and feng shui consultants as well as a wide range of unique furniture, accessories and original art resources.” “Every property is unique and we believe every staging should be unique. We work hard to customize each project. You’ll never see the same set design.” “These days, we perform a lot of staging ‘triage.’ It’s our job to have our clients invest the least amount where they will get the maximum return.” Prior to her staging career, Anne spent 20+ years in senior-level marketing positions. She credits her corporate experiences with honing her desire for tangible results, sensitivity to client needs and budgets, excellent communication skills and a high level of professionalism. A former senior level marketing executive as well as an avid photographer and artist, Anne’s staging career is the perfect intersection of her marketing and design experiences and love of real estate. She enjoys sharing her passion and knowledge of staging through speaking engagements, as well as mentoring and coaching junior stagers. Anne has lived in NYC since 1979 and is a graduate of Stanford University. |
